What Is the Cost of Living Near Seattle?

Understanding the cost of living near Seattle is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Cadd Northwest.
Seattle's Cost of Living Index is approximately 152.7 (52.7% more expensive than US average; 36.8% more than WA average). Major tech hub (Amazon, Microsoft nearby), extremely high housing costs. King County Metro, Sound Transit. When planning your budget based on a salary from Cadd Northwest,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$2,000 - $3,000+ A significant portion of Cadd Northwest sal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$130 - $220 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$99 (ORCA mon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$500 - $750 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$550 - $1,000+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$430 - $800+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$3,709 - $5,779+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
